Transaction 17865a6aefe6603e805cea82ac3a24c300b32f8cbb6a19a4090ce2bbe0113568
1 Input
1 Output
-
17865a6aefe6603e805cea82ac3a24c300b32f8cbb6a19a4090ce2bbe0113568:0
- value
- 15100
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d24a16d2268a71a8a24af3e8f5dc819df721cd23dd855395797fd9c697d25750
- address
- tb1p6f9pd53x3fc63gj27050thypnhmjrnfrmkz489te0lvud97j2agqfkt0gl